My dealer was finally able to resolve the problem!

They kept my car for a couple of days but were able to trace the issue to a leak in the body seam under the windshield, RIGHT above the microphone. They sealed it and the mic is perfect.
If anyone else is having a similar issue I urge you to get your dealer to check you windshield for leaks around the Mic.
